A simple photocathode for electron injection into high-density gas is described. Relatively large electronic current pulses have been obtained by using a commerical low-power xenon flash lamp. The photocathode efficiency has been studied as a function of the metal film thickness. The device has been used in swarm experiments at pressures up to 10 MPa in the temperature range 40–300 K.
